CO2 emissions from cars and vans post-2020 - divisions between Left/Liberals/Greens and Right/Conservatives at European Parliament
Brussels, 04/09/2018 (Agence Europe)

A dividing line is beginning to take shape between MEPs at the S&D, ALDE, Greens/EFA, GUE/NGL and ELDD on the one hand, and MEPs at the EPP and ECR, on the other, in view of the vote on 10 September at the European Parliament's environment committee. The vote will focus on last November's draft regulation to reduce CO2 emissions from passenger cars and new vans by 30% by 2030, with an interim target of -15% by 2025 (see EUROPE 11948, 11942).
